> I have some questions regarding BPDU /BPDU Guard
>
> Q1.
> Does Configuring portfast prevent sending BPDU at that port.
> no, portfast puts the port into the forwarding stage of the STP alogrithm
> upon connectivity. A BPDU will be sent to this port if the connection to
> this port introduces a loop.

> Q2.
> Can I disable spantree on a particular port
> no, you can disable spanning tree on a per vlan basis only.

>
> Q3.
> Will BPDU Gurad will disable BPDU packet at a particular port.
> no, with BPDU guard enabled, the port upon detecting a BPDU will be shut
> down

>
> Q4. Which is the best way to prevent BPDU on a particular port.

BPDU's will be seen on ports that have connections to other layer 2
devices. If a BPDU is seen at any other port than you have a loop.
